Hidersine 1VA Viola Rosin (Light / Medium-Hard)
Product Description
Developed in England after years of requests from violists, Hidersine 1VA Viola Rosin is a purpose-built formulation designed specifically for the viola’s lower register and thicker string profile.
While many violists have historically relied on violin rosin, Hidersine took a more deliberate approach—carefully re-engineering both the core mixture and the processing method to meet the unique demands of the instrument. The result is a rosin that delivers noticeably improved control while enhancing the viola’s naturally rich, vocal sound.
Rated at Grip Profile #5, the 1VA sits squarely between harder “light” violin rosins and softer dark rosins. This balance provides confident grip and traction without sacrificing clarity or free response, making it especially well-suited to the viola’s tonal range. It performs reliably in temperate to warm climates, offering consistent playability across a wide variety of settings.
As with all Hidersine rosins, the 1VA is still made the traditional way in England—hand-mixed and hand-poured using carefully selected colophony and natural waxes. The large 30g cake ensures long service life, whether in the practice room, studio, or on stage.

Specifications
Instrument: Viola
Type: Light (Amber), Medium-Hard
Sound Character: Rich, Vocal
Grip Profile Rating: #5 (Balanced grip and traction)
Temperature Profile: Temperate to warm climates
Primary Constituents: Colophony, natural waxes
Cake Size: Large
Weight: Approx. 30g
Country of Origin: England, United Kingdom
Manufacturing Process: Historic artisanal method (hand-mixed, hand-poured)
